OL 9 must not have unauthorized IP tunnels configured.

Description
IP tunneling mechanisms can be used to bypass network filtering. If tunneling is required, it must be documented with the information system security officer (ISSO).

Check Text (C-75913r1092638_chk)
Verify that OL 9 does not have unauthorized IP tunnels configured.

Determine if the IPsec service is active with the following command:

$ systemctl status ipsec
ipsec.service - Internet Key Exchange (IKE) Protocol Daemon for IPsec
Loaded: loaded (/usr/lib/systemd/system/ipsec.service; disabled)
Active: inactive (dead)

If the IPsec service is active, check for configured IPsec connections ("conn"), with the following command:

$ grep -rni conn /etc/ipsec.conf /etc/ipsec.d/

Verify any returned results are documented with the ISSO.

If the IPsec tunnels are active and not approved, this is a finding.
Fix Text (F-75820r1092300_fix)
Remove all unapproved tunnels from the system, or document them with the ISSO.
